Excel Solver is a powerful tool that can help you with curve fitting, optimization, and analysis of data. Whether you're a seasoned data analyst or just starting out with Excel, mastering the art of curve fitting using Solver can elevate your data manipulation skills to the next level. In this guide, we’ll dive into seven tips that will help you master Excel Solver for effective curve fitting, while avoiding common pitfalls and troubleshooting issues along the way. Let’s jump right in! 🚀
Understanding Curve Fitting in Excel
Curve fitting is the process of constructing a curve that has the best fit to a series of data points. In Excel, this can be accomplished using various methods, but the Solver feature allows for more complex models that can improve accuracy. By using Solver, you can optimize the parameters of your chosen curve model based on your data.
Step-by-Step Guide to Curve Fitting with Solver
Before we dive into the tips, let’s outline the basic steps to set up curve fitting with Solver in Excel.
-
Prepare Your Data:
- Input your data points in two columns: X values and Y values.
- Create a scatter plot to visualize your data.
-
Choose a Curve Model:
- Decide on the type of curve you want to fit (linear, polynomial, exponential, etc.).
-
Set Up the Model:
- In another column, create a formula to represent your chosen curve model using parameters (e.g., coefficients) that you will optimize.
-
Calculate Residuals:
- Create a column to calculate the residuals (differences between observed and predicted Y values).
-
Set Up the Solver:
- Go to the Data tab, click on Solver, and set it to minimize the sum of squared residuals by changing the coefficients of your curve model.
-
Run Solver:
- Click “Solve” and let Solver optimize the parameters.
-
Evaluate the Fit:
- Review the outputs and graph the fitted curve against your original data points.
Now that we've established a basic understanding, let's explore some tips to make this process smoother and more efficient!
7 Tips for Mastering Excel Solver Curve Fitting
1. Start Simple
When beginning your curve fitting journey, it’s important to start with simpler models, like linear or polynomial functions. This allows you to get comfortable with the Solver tool. Once you’ve nailed the basics, you can explore more complex models.
2. Use Adequate Data Range
Selecting an appropriate data range is crucial for accurate fitting. Ensure that your X and Y data includes all relevant points without any outliers that could skew results. If you have a considerable amount of data, using only the most pertinent points can sometimes lead to better fitting.
3. Visualize Your Results
After running Solver, always visualize your fitted curve against the actual data points. A well-fitted model should closely follow the trends in your data. Use Excel's charting tools to create a scatter plot with your curve overlayed. This will provide immediate feedback on the performance of your model.
4. Experiment with Different Models
Don’t settle for the first curve model you try. Experiment with different types of models (e.g., logarithmic, exponential, polynomial). Some datasets may fit better with non-linear models than linear ones. The key is to validate each model against your data to find the best match.
5. Analyze the Residuals
Once you have a fitted curve, it's crucial to analyze the residuals. A good fitting model should show randomly distributed residuals. If you notice patterns in the residuals, this could indicate that your model is missing key variables or that it is not the best fit for the data.
6. Pay Attention to Solver Settings
Solver has several options that can impact the optimization results:
- Convergence: This defines how closely the solution should approach the target. Adjusting this can help with models that have a lot of fluctuation.
- Tolerances: Setting tighter tolerances may lead to better solutions but could also increase run time.
Experiment with these settings to find the optimal configurations for your data.
7. Document Your Process
Maintaining documentation of your steps, including model types tested, settings used, and results obtained, can be invaluable. If you need to revisit your work in the future or share it with others, a well-documented process ensures you can easily reconstruct your findings.
Common Mistakes to Avoid
-
Ignoring Outliers: Outliers can have a significant effect on the curve fitting process, skewing results. Always examine your data for anomalies.
-
Overfitting the Model: Too complex of a model may fit the current dataset well but will not predict new data accurately. Aim for simplicity when possible.
-
Neglecting the Data Visualization: Failing to visualize your results can lead to missing critical insights about your model's effectiveness.
Troubleshooting Issues
Even the best tools can run into issues. Here are some common problems you might encounter while using Excel Solver for curve fitting, along with their solutions.
Solver Does Not Converge
- Ensure Correct Formulas: Double-check that your curve model is correctly inputted and that you are calculating residuals accurately.
- Adjust Solver Settings: Tweak the options under Solver to see if that helps improve convergence.
Results Don't Make Sense
- Examine Your Data: Verify that your data is accurate and relevant. Sometimes the issue lies in the data itself rather than the modeling technique.
- Try Different Models: If the initial model doesn’t yield plausible results, consider trying another approach.
<div class="faq-section">
<div class="faq-container"> <h2>Frequently Asked Questions</h2> <div class="faq-item"> <div class="faq-question"> <h3>What types of curves can I fit using Excel Solver?</h3> <span class="faq-toggle">+</span> </div> <div class="faq-answer"> <p>You can fit various curves such as linear, polynomial, exponential, and logarithmic using Excel Solver.</p> </div> </div> <div class="faq-item"> <div class="faq-question"> <h3>How do I know if my curve fit is accurate?</h3> <span class="faq-toggle">+</span> </div> <div class="faq-answer"> <p>Visualize your fitted curve alongside your actual data points. Residual analysis can also indicate the accuracy of the fit.</p> </div> </div> <div class="faq-item"> <div class="faq-question"> <h3>Can I use Solver for multiple datasets at once?</h3> <span class="faq-toggle">+</span> </div> <div class="faq-answer"> <p>Excel Solver can only handle one dataset at a time. You would need to run separate Solver sessions for multiple datasets.</p> </div> </div> </div> </div>
Mastering Excel Solver for curve fitting opens up a plethora of possibilities for data analysis. From creating models that predict trends to optimizing solutions for business scenarios, these skills are valuable. Remember to be patient with yourself as you practice these techniques. The more you use Solver, the more proficient you'll become.
It’s time to put these tips into action! Start experimenting with your data, explore different models, and see how well you can optimize your curve fitting skills with Excel Solver.
<p class="pro-note">🌟Pro Tip: Always back up your data before making extensive changes or fitting models to avoid losing any important information.</p>